How to Make Your Boss Your Ally and Advocate is intended to help you in specific, practical ways as you initiate action to improve and grow with your current boss and all who follow.
Section I will help you learn more about yourself, so you can understand what you bring to the relationship.
Section II will enable you to analyze your boss's personality and management style, so you will know what kind of an animal you are dealing with.
Section III lays the groundwork for a positive, mutually beneficial relationship that allows you and your boss to achieve your goals.
Section IV gives you pointers on how to maintain the relationship, and tells you what to do when it isn't working.
